A catch-all feature that is enabled for a given email mailbox will allow you to receive email messages that are sent to addresses that do not actually exist. To put it differently, if you delete an email address and somebody still sends a message to it, or to any mistyped email address under the exact same domain, you will receive the message in the catch-all mailbox. Using this feature implies that you won’t miss an email for any reason, which could be crucial in case you run a company, for instance. Since you may begin receiving unsolicited email messages, you can combine the catch-all feature with anti-spam filters so as to receive only real emails in your inbox. Only one mailbox per domain name can be a catch-all one and email forwarding cannot be activated for a catch-all mailbox.
